The pickups buzz when you touch their casings? Are you sure you didn't wire the hot/ground wires in reverse? Many pickups will ground the metal pickup chassis/casing or polepieces with a wire that merges with the ground connection lead. If you reversed the leads, then the metal components would be in the hot signal path instead of directly grounded which could cause the buzzing. I would suggest attempting to switch the leads on each pickup and see if that solves it. Sometimes a pickup will actually have 3 leads (so a seperate one for grounding the metal components and shielding in the pickup itself), but I'm guessing the Chi-sonics only have the two...
 
This happened on my ChiSonic Glaub and I tried switching the leads and it didn't work. I then talked with the factory. They recommended copper shielding foil on the underside of the pickup to ground the cover and reduce noise. The foil has to have electrically conductive adhesive, then you run a ground wire from the foil to the controls.

Noise dropped way down to almost nothing and no buzz when I touch the cover anymore.

So the only thing you changed was that you added foil to the bottom of the pickup covers, soldered a wire to the foil, then to ground- you left the other leads as is?

It sounds to me like when you put foil on the front pickup, part of the "hot" lead must have been in contact with the foil, grounding it out. This would explain why the other pickup cuts out when you turn the front pickup up, because you are basically blending in a grounded signal rather than a live signal (when its turned all the way up, the shorted hot wire has no resistance in between it and your main hot output signal, so it cuts out all signal from the bass).

To fix it, either try to locate somewhere where the bare hot lead might be in contact with the conductive foil (like a torn wire cover, or right where the hot lead exits from the pickup casing), or else reverse the original two leads on BOTH pickups- this will mean the short to ground that you are experiencing now will be directed to ground anyway instead of the hot connection. And the tone from the pickups should be the same with the leads reversed.
